P1C7F – BMW DTC

BMW DTC P1C7F – Universal Charger Extension Control Module DC/DC Converter Voltage Sensor Circuit Range/Performance

DTC P1C7F meaning on BMW

DTC P1C7F on a BMW refers to the Universal Charger Extension Control Module DC/DC Converter Voltage Sensor Circuit Range/Performance. This diagnostic trouble code indicates an issue with the voltage sensor circuit of the DC/DC converter within the Universal Charger Extension Control Module.

BMW DTC P1C7F symptoms

Symptoms of BMW DTC P1C7F may include erratic charging behavior, battery not charging properly, warning lights related to the charging system appearing on the dashboard, and potential issues with the vehicle’s electrical system.

BMW DTC P1C7F causes

The causes of BMW DTC P1C7F can vary and may include faulty wiring in the voltage sensor circuit, a malfunctioning DC/DC converter, issues with the Universal Charger Extension Control Module, or problems with the battery or charging system components.

BMW DTC P1C7F seriousness

Ignoring BMW DTC P1C7F can lead to potential charging system failures, which may result in the vehicle not starting, electrical system malfunctions, and ultimately, a breakdown. It is important to address this issue promptly to avoid further complications.

How to diagnose DTC P1C7F on BMW

To diagnose BMW DTC P1C7F, a mechanic would typically use a diagnostic scanner to retrieve the trouble codes stored in the vehicle’s computer system. They would then perform a visual inspection of the charging system components, check the wiring for any damage, and test the voltage sensor circuit and DC/DC converter for proper functionality.

How to fix DTC P1C7F on BMW

Fixing BMW DTC P1C7F may involve repairing or replacing the faulty wiring in the voltage sensor circuit, replacing the DC/DC converter if it is malfunctioning, addressing any issues with the Universal Charger Extension Control Module, and ensuring that the battery and charging system components are in good working condition.

How to erase DTC P1C7F on BMW

Once the underlying issue causing BMW DTC P1C7F has been resolved, the diagnostic trouble code can be cleared using a diagnostic scanner. The mechanic would clear the code from the vehicle’s computer system, and if the repair was successful, the DTC should not reappear.
